The average height of a shiitake mushroom (Lentinula edodes) typically ranges from 2 to 5 inches (5 to 12 centimeters). The cap diameter can vary from about 2 to 10 inches, depending on the growing conditions. Shiitake mushrooms are known for their distinctive umbrella-shaped caps and can be cultivated on logs or sawdust.
Mushrooms are multicellular organisms. They are made up of a network of threads called hyphae that form the main body of the fungus, known as the mycelium. The visible part of the mushroom, known as the fruiting body, is also multicellular.

The phoenix oyster mushroom, scientifically known as Pleurotus pulmonarius, is a type of edible fungus belonging to the oyster mushroom family. It features a fan-shaped, delicate cap that can range in color from white to light brown, and has a mild, slightly sweet flavor. This mushroom is known for its fast growth and is often cultivated for culinary use, adding texture and taste to various dishes. Additionally, it thrives in warm weather and can be found growing on decaying wood.

The yellow flat top mushroom, also known as the golden oyster mushroom, is characterized by its vibrant yellow color and flat, fan-shaped cap. It has a mild, slightly sweet flavor and a delicate texture. These mushrooms are commonly used in stir-fries, soups, and salads, as well as in vegetarian and vegan dishes as a meat substitute. They are also known for their nutritional benefits, as they are low in calories and fat, but high in protein, fiber, and various vitamins and minerals.

A bell-shaped cnidarian adapted for swimming is known as a medusa. Medusae have a jelly-like, umbrella-shaped body with tentacles hanging down and are capable of free-swimming movements in the water. They are typically the adult form of cnidarians, with the polyp form being the stationary phase in the life cycle.
